WebI have personally seen tanks go from 80ppm nitrate down to 10ppm just by cleaning a neglected canister. They can do a lot of damage just by running if they are not maintained properly. Cleaning them usually means dragging them out to a utility sink or bath tub and spending 30-60 minutes cleaning them. Disadvantages … WebCanister Filter A canister filter is essentially filtration in a plastic cylinder or box form factor that often sits under the tank, with intake and output hoses that reach into the aquarium. With the aid of a motor, water is drawn into the canister, travels through several trays of filter media, and then is returned to the fish tank.
